FAQ Airport Car Rental

How do I find the rental counter?

Your voucher will display the rental company’s address and provide directions to the counter.

At airports, look for signs featuring a car with a key above it. They may also indicate ‘Rent a car’ or ‘Car rental’.

How do I drop the car off at the end of my rental?

Simply ask the counter staff when you pick up your car.

If no one is available when you need to return the car, such as during late hours, there may be a ‘drop box’ for the key. Confirm this with the counter staff at pick-up.

It’s always advisable to keep any paperwork provided to you.

What happens if my flight is delayed or cancelled?

If you have provided your flight details during booking, the rental company may track your flight and hold your car for a grace period in case of delays or cancellations, though this is not guaranteed.

Details about any grace period can be found under ‘Important information’ and then ‘Grace period’ in your rental terms.

If your flight is delayed or cancelled, notify the rental company as soon as possible using the phone number on your rental voucher.

Flight delays and cancellations are beyond our control, and we cannot be held responsible for any related issues or costs.

How do I pay for my car?

When booking your car, you can use most credit or debit cards for payment (accepted cards will be specified).

However, few rental companies accept debit cards for the security deposit at the rental counter. Therefore, the main driver typically needs to present a credit card in their own name when picking up the car. It does not need to be the same card used for the booking.

What do I need to take to pick the car up?

The main driver must bring:

  1. A credit card in their own name with sufficient funds for the deposit (some rental companies may accept debit cards).
  2. A valid driving license held for at least two years (some companies may require longer).
  3. Your voucher.

Additional documents may be required in some cases, and always will be communicated beforehand by your local car rental company before you arrive at the airport.

If other drivers will be using the car, they must also present their driving licenses.

Important: Without all necessary documents, the counter staff will not release the car. Please review the rental terms under ‘What you need at pick-up’.
